WebSo for each of the 3 domains of the PMP Exam (People, Process, and Business Environment), you will get a score as per the scale above. Your total score is a function … Web5 apr. 2024 · Up until 2005, the pass rate for the PMP certification exam was 61%. PMP candidates had to score 120 questions out of the 175 scorable questions. Twenty-five of the 200 questions in the exam were pilot questions and were not added to the final score.
